Select to view content in your preferred language

Provide setting for sort order of Filter Widget values lists

736
3
01-06-2024 10:50 AM
Status: Open
Mike_Koutnik
Regular Contributor

One VERY nice feature in Web AppBuilder is being able to explicitly set the presentation order of values in a predefined choice list. Apparently, Experience Builder automatically sorts value choices alphabetically. That option surely has some utility for some. But for our needs, allowing explicit placement is far superior. We have several long lists of choices in one application. Some dictated by regulations or policy, others by convention. Users a very familiar with these choices being presented in a specific order. In each case, there is an inherent grouping of the individual choices they are familiar with a comfortable with and makes sense to them. To not see those options in the familiar order is disorienting to them.

It would be VERY helpful if an option could simply be offered NOT sort filter value choice lists and just use the order of choices as configured in the builder.

Thanks

3 Comments
AndrewBowne

YES!  This would be particularly helpful when sorting days of the week....  I can't tell you how many complaints I get about the days of the week being in alphabetical and not logical order.

Geraldine

I need this too in Experience Builder. Would be at least useful to sort based on the codes (integers in my case - 1, 2, 3 and so on) and not on the labels/descriptions. In other widgets like the table widget, you get the values list ordered by the codes though. Why not in the filter?filter.png

ryan_grammer

Hello all, this has already been logged as ENH-000150684: "In the ArcGIS Experience Builder Filter widget, provide the ability to keep the order of the predefined values."

Please reach out to Esri Technical Support and open a case to have your account added to this enhancement request. The support ticket request can be submitted as, "I am running into a known limitation when trying to change the display order of predefined values in the Filter widget (ArcGIS Experience Builder). There is an enhancement for this issue, ENH-000150684, and I would like to be added to it."

Thank you,

Ryan Grammer | ArcGIS Enterprise Support Analyst